Abstract

Official abstract text for this publication.

A modified conjugated diene-based polymer, and more particularly, a modified conjugated diene-based polymer having a unimodal molecular weight distribution curve measured by gel permeation chromatography (GPC), molecular weight distribution (PDI; MWD) of less than 1.7, and a Si content of 100 ppm or more based on weight, and a rubber composition including the same.

First claim

Opening claim text (preview).

The invention claimed is: 1. A modified conjugated diene-based polymer having: a unimodal molecular weight distribution curve measured by gel permeation chromatography (GPC), a molecular weight distribution (PDI; MWD) of 1.0 or more and less than 1.7, and a Si content of 100 ppm or more based on a total weight of the modified conjugated diene-based polymer, wherein the modified conjugated diene-based polymer is a homopolymer comprising a repeat unit derived from a conjugated diene-based monomer. 2. The modified conjugated diene-based polymer of claim 1 , further comprising a repeating unit derived from a conjugated diene-based monomer and a functional group derived from a modifier. 3. The modified conjugated diene-based polymer of claim 2 , wherein the modifier is an alkoxysilane-based modifier. 4. The modified conjugated diene-based polymer of claim 1 , wherein the modified conjugated diene-based polymer has a number average molecular weight (Mn) of 1,000 g/mol to 2,000,000 g/mol, and a weight average molecular weight (Mw) of 1,000 g/mol to 3,000,000 g/mol. 5. The modified conjugated diene-based polymer of claim 1 , wherein a Mooney viscosity is 30 or more at 100° C. 6. A rubber composition comprising the modified conjugated diene-based polymer according to claim 1 , and a filler. 7. The rubber composition of claim 6 , wherein the rubber composition comprises 0.1 parts by weight to 200 parts by weight of the filler based on 100 parts by weight of the modified conjugated diene-based polymer. 8. The rubber composition of claim 6 , wherein the filler is a silica-based filler or a carbon black-based filler. 9. The rubber composition of claim 6 , wherein a Mooney viscosity is from 59 to 74 at 100° C. 10. A method for preparing the modified conjugated diene-based polymer of claim 1 comprising: (S1) polymerizing a conjugated diene-based monomer, or an aromatic vinyl-based monomer and a conjugated diene-based monomer, in a hydrocarbon solvent including an organometallic compound to prepare an active polymer; and (S2) reacting the active polymer prepared in (S1) with a modifier, wherein the active polymer is coupled with an organometal, the step (S1) is continuously performed in two or more polymerization reactors, and a polymerization conversion ratio in a first polymerization reactor is 50% or less. 11. The method of claim 10 , wherein the polymerization of step (S1) is conducted in a temperature range of 80° C. or less.
